The Intersection of Elections and Organ Transplants: A Discussion on Policy and Access

Introduction: Elections play a crucial role in shaping policies and systems that govern various aspects of our society. One area where the impact of elections becomes particularly significant is organ transplantation. In this blog post, we will explore how elections influence the policy landscape surrounding organ transplants and how they can potentially affect access to life-saving procedures. 1. Policy Frameworks: Elections often lead to changes in policy frameworks, which can have a direct impact on organ transplantation. Different political parties may have differing priorities and beliefs when it comes to healthcare, leading to potential shifts in legislation surrounding organ transplantation. For instance, certain political platforms may prioritize improving organ donor registration and increasing availability, while others may focus on funding research for alternative methods or ensuring equitable distribution. 2. Funding and Resources: Elections can influence the allocation of funding and resources for organ transplant programs. The outcome of an election can determine whether governments prioritize investment in the infrastructure necessary for successful organ transplantation, such as transplant centers, organ procurement organizations, and research initiatives. Depending on the election results, funding may increase, leading to improved access and quality of care, or conversely, it may decrease, potentially affecting the availability of organ transplant services. 3. Healthcare Frameworks: Healthcare systems and policies vary across different countries, and the results of elections can lead to significant changes in these frameworks. In countries with nationalized healthcare systems, the outcomes of elections can determine the overall accessibility and affordability of organ transplantation. Political choices on how healthcare is funded, regulated, and delivered can impact the access and availability of organs for transplantation. 4. Public Awareness and Education: Elections provide an opportunity to raise awareness about organ transplantation and related issues. Political campaigns and debates often shed light on the challenges faced by individuals in need of transplants and highlight the importance of increasing organ donation rates. Candidates may champion policies that promote public education and awareness campaigns targeted at addressing misconceptions and encouraging more individuals to become organ donors. 5. Ethical Considerations: Elections can spark discussions about ethical dilemmas related to organ transplantation. Candidates and policymakers may propose ethical guidelines for organ allocation, addressing topics such as prioritization based on factors like age, medical urgency, or resource allocation. The outcome of an election can shape these ethical considerations, impacting the fairness and inclusivity of the transplant process. Conclusion: Elections have a profound impact on healthcare systems and policies, and organ transplantation is no exception. From influencing policy frameworks and funding to raising public awareness and addressing ethical considerations, elections play a crucial role in shaping the landscape of organ transplantation. Understanding how elections intersect with this vital healthcare issue is essential to ensure equitable access to life-saving procedures and enhance the overall efficacy of organ transplant programs.
